
Neoenergia and EIB announce EUR 300 million green financing agreement to modernize Bahia's electricity grid
In July 2025, the EIB and Neoenergia signed a contract to support the modernization of the electricity grid in Brazil's fifth largest state
The initiative supports Brazil's climate objectives and the European Union's Global Gateway Strategy
The agreement was announced during the 30th United Nations Climate Change Conference (COP30) in Belém, Brazil
The electricity distribution network in the state of Bahia will be modernized with the support of a EUR 300 million loan granted by EIB Global - the development arm of the European Investment Bank Group - to Neoenergia Coelba, a distributor serving more than 6 million customers in 415 municipalities in Bahia.
The funding will be used to expand the electricity network and build new connections, as well as investing in automation equipment, contributing to the modernization of the distribution network. The company will use the loan granted by EIB Global to carry out projects that will allow more people, especially in low-income communities, to have access to clean energy in Bahia, the fifth largest state in the country, with a population of close to 15 million. The project is also in line with Brazil's goals of improving energy efficiency and expanding the use of renewable energy sources over the next decade.
In addition, the financing offers competitive commercial conditions and is the result of a rigorous technical and environmental due diligence process, representing a strategic opportunity available only to a select group of Brazilian companies that meet the highest international standards.
During the 30th United Nations Climate Change Conference (COP30) in Belém, Brazil, representatives from the EIB and Neoenergia took part in a ceremony to celebrate the partnership, whose agreement was signed in July this year, highlighting the project's alignment with Brazil's climate objectives and the European Union's Global Gateway Strategy.

The project, which is to be implemented over the next few years, is part of the Green Deal signed between the European Union and Brazil, and is also of strategic importance to the EU as part of its Global Gateway investment program.
The project reinforces Brazil's commitments under the Paris Agreement, signed in 2015 to combat climate change, and contributes to the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development, adopted by the United Nations.
Global Gateway
The Global Gateway is the European Union's positive proposal that seeks to reduce global disparities in terms of investment, promote smart, clean and secure connections in the digital, energy and transport sectors, and strengthen health, education and research systems. The Global Gateway Strategy brings together the EU, Member States and European development finance institutions, which together aim to mobilize up to EUR 300 billion in public and private investment between 2021 and 2027.

General information
The European Investment Bank (EIB) is the European Union's long-term financing institution, whose capital is held by the Member States. It finances investments that contribute to achieving the EU's strategic objectives, based on eight key priorities: climate action and the environment, digitalization and technological innovation, security and defence, cohesion, agriculture and the bioeconomy, social infrastructure, a stronger Europe in a more peaceful and prosperous world, and the Capital Markets Union.
The EIB Group, which also includes the European Investment Fund (EIF), has contracted almost EUR 89 billion in new financing for more than 900 high-impact projects by 2024, strengthening Europe's competitiveness and security.
Around half of EIB financing in the EU goes to cohesion regions, which have lower per capita income than the EU average, while around 60% of the EIB Group's annual investments support climate action and environmental sustainability.
